OverviewLos ojos del coronel es la historia de Opalina Lamar, mejor conocida como La Divina, y su incesante y obsesiva búsqueda de la identidad de su padre. Una serie de sucesos, aparentemente sin conexión, le dan las pistas necesarias para desentrañar el enigma que la ha acompañado a lo largo de su vida. En un desenlace inesperado, el destino desmorona sus planes tan minuciosamente elaborados, forzándola a enfrentarse a una situación que no había previsto. Language: Spanish Table of ContentsReviewsAuthor InformationCARLOS RUBIO was born in Cuba and came to the United States while still an adolescent. After finishing high school, he attended Concord College, West Virginia University and the University of Maryland. A bilingual novelist, in Spanish he has written Saga, Orisha and Hubris. In 1989 his novel Quadrivium received the Nuevo Leóoacute;n International Prize for Novels. In English he is the the author of Orpheus's Blues, Secret Memories and American Triptych, a trilogy of satirical novels. In 2004 his novel Dead Time received Foreword's Magazine Book of the Year Award. His novel Forgotten Objects was published by Editions Dedicaces in 2014 and was a finalist in the Readers Choice Awards in 2015. More recently, his novel Doble Filo was a finalist in the 2018 Reinaldo Arenas International Prize for Novels and published in 2019 by Ediciones Alféeacute;izar in Spain.
